Summary

The time for a motion to be heard in Harris County, Texas, generally ranges from 2-4 weeks. The court schedules a hearing date after receiving the motion. Expedited hearings can be requested by demonstrating an immediate need or urgency. Contact the court clerk or a legal professional for more guidance.
